Encouraging verses for times of difficulty

1.      Psalm 23:4

"Even though I walk through the darkest valley, I will fear no evil, for you are with me; your rod and your staff, they comfort me." (NIV)

This verse from Psalm 23 is a source of comfort and encouragement, reminding us that even in our darkest moments, God is with us, providing comfort and protection.

2.      Isaiah 41:10

"So do not fear, for I am with you; do not be d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you; I will uphold you with my righteous right hand." (NIV)

In this verse, God reminds us of His presence and promise to strengthen and help us, providing comfort and encouragement in difficult times.

3.      Deuteronomy 31:8

"The Lord himself goes before you and will be with you; he will never leave you nor forsake you. Do not be afraid; do not be discouraged." (NIV)

This verse from Deuteronomy reminds us that God is always with us, never leaving or forsaking us. This promise of God's presence provides comfort and encouragement in difficult times.

4.      Philippians 4:13

"I can do all this through him who gives me strength." (NIV)

This verse from Philippians reminds us that through our faith in Jesus Christ, we can find the strength to face any challenge or difficulty.

 

Verses for when we need comfort

1.      Matthew 11:28-30

"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est. Take my yoke upon you and learn from me, for I am gentle and humble in heart, and you will find rest for your souls. For my yoke is easy and my burden is light." (NIV)

In this verse, Jesus invites us to come to Him for rest and comfort, offering a respite from the burdens of life.

2.      John 14:27

"Peace I leave with you; my peace I give you. I do not give to you as the world gives. Do not let your hearts be troubled and do not be afraid." (NIV)

In this verse, Jesus offers us His peace, which is unlike anything the world can offer. This peace brings comfort and calm to troubled hearts.

3.      2 Corinthians 1:3-4

"Praise be to the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, the Father of compassion and the God of all comfort, who comforts us in all our troubles, so that we can comfort those in any trouble with the comfort we ourselves receive from God." (NIV)

This verse from 2 Corinthians reminds us that God is the source of all comfort and compassion, and that He comforts us in our own troubles so that we can in turn comfort others.

 

Verses for finding strength

1.      Isaiah 40:31

"But those who hope in the Lord will renew their strength. They will soar on wings like eagles; they will run and not grow weary; they will walk and not be faint." (NIV)

This verse reminds us that when we place our hope in the Lord, we will find strength to renew our energy and carry on, even when we feel weary.

2.      James 5:16

"Therefore, confess your sins to each other and pray for each other so that you may be healed. The prayer of a righteous person is powerful and effective." (NIV)

This verse reminds us of the power of prayer, and how the prayers of a righteous person can bring healing and strength.

3.      1 Corinthians 10:13

"No temptation has overtaken you except what is common to mankind. And God is faithful; he will not let you be tempted beyond what you can bear. But when you are tempted, he will also provide a way out so that you can endure it." (NIV)

This verse reminds us that God is faithful and that He will not let us be tempted beyond what we can bear. He provides us with a way out and the strength to endure temptation.
